Supplemental Restraint System (SRS) ªAIR
BAGº and ªSEAT BELT PRE-TENSIONERº
The Supplemental Restraint System such as ªAIR BAGº and ªSEAT BELT PRE-TENSIONERº used along with
a seat belt, helps to reduce the risk or severity of injury to the driver and front passenger for certain types of
collision. The SRS composition which is available to NISSAN MODEL R20 is as follows (The composition
varies according to the destination and optional equipment.):
IFor a frontal collision
The Supplemental Restraint System consists of driver air bag module (located in the center of the steer-
ing wheel), front passenger air bag module (located on the instrument panel on passenger side), front seat
belt pre-tensioners, a diagnosis sensor unit, warning lamp, wiring harness and spiral cable.
I For a side collision
The Supplemental Restraint System consists of front side air bag module (located in the outer side of front
seat), side air bag (satellite) sensor, diagnosis sensor unit (one of components of air bags for a frontal
collision), wiring harness, warning lamp (one of components of air bags for a frontal collision).
WARNING:
I To avoid rendering the SRS inoperative, which could increase the risk of personal injury or death
in the event of a collision which would result in air bag inflation, all maintenance should be per-
formed by an authorized NISSAN dealer.
I Improper maintenance, including incorrect removal and installation of the SRS, can lead to per-
sonal injury caused by unintentional activation of the system.
I Do not use electrical test equipment on any circuit related to the SRS unless instructed to in this
Service Manual. Spiral cable and wiring harnesses covered with yellow insulation tape either just
before the harness connectors or for the complete harness are related to the SRS.
Precautions for SRS ªAIR BAGº and ªSEAT
BELT PRE-TENSIONERº Service
IDo not use electrical test equipment to check SRS circuits unless instructed to in this Service Manual.
I Before servicing the SRS, turn ignition switch ªOFFº, disconnect both battery cables and wait at least 3
minutes.
For approximately 3 minutes after the cables are removed, it is still possible for the air bag and seat belt
pre-tensioner to deploy. Therefore, do not work on any SRS connectors or wires until at least 3 minutes
have passed.
I Diagnosis sensor unit must always be installed with their arrow marks ª +º pointing towards the front of
the vehicle for proper operation. Also check diagnosis sensor unit for cracks, deformities or rust before
installation and replace as required.
I The spiral cable must be aligned with the neutral position since its rotations are limited. Do not attempt to
turn steering wheel or column after removal of steering gear.
I Handle air bag module carefully. Always place driver and front passenger air bag modules with the pad
side facing upward and place front side air bag module (built-in type) standing with stud bolt side setting
bottom.
I Conduct self-diagnosis to check entire SRS for proper function after replacing any components.
I After air bag inflates, the front instrument panel assembly should be replaced if damaged.
Precautions
IBefore proceeding with disassembly, thoroughly clean the outside of the transmission. It is important to
prevent the internal parts from becoming contaminated by dirt or other foreign matter.
I Disassembly should be done in a clean work area.
I Use lint-free cloth or towels for wiping parts clean. Common shop rags can leave fibers that could inter-
fere with the operation of the transmission.
I Place disassembled parts in order for easier and proper assembly.
I All parts should be carefully cleaned with a general purpose, non-flammable solvent before inspection or
reassembly.
I Gaskets, seals and O-rings should be replaced any time the transmission is disassembled.
I It is very important to perform functional tests whenever they are indicated.
I The valve body contains precision parts and requires extreme care when parts are removed and serviced.
Place removed parts in a parts rack in order to replace them in correct positions and sequences. Care will
also prevent springs and small parts from becoming scattered or lost.
I Properly installed valves, sleeves, plugs, etc. will slide along bores in valve body under their own weight.

Front Wheel Alignment
Before checking front wheel alignment, be sure to make a prelimi-
nary inspection.
PRELIMINARY INSPECTION
1. Check the tires for wear and proper inflation.
2. Check the wheel runout.Wheel runout:Refer to SDS, FA-39.
3. Check the front wheel bearings for looseness.
4. Check the front suspension for looseness.
5. Check the steering linkage for looseness.
6. Check that the front shock absorbers work properly by using the standard bounce test.
7. Measure vehicle height (Unladen): H = A þ B mm (in) Refer to SDS, FA-39.
(1) Exercise the front suspension by bouncing the front of the vehicle 4 or 5 times to ensure that vehicle is in a neutral height
attitude.
(2) Measure wheel alignment. Refer to SDS, FA-39.
(3) Measure vehicle posture ... Dimension ªHº. Refer to SDS, FA-39.
If ªHº dimension is not within the specified value, readjust
vehicle posture using anchor arm adjusting nut.
Refer to ªINSTALLATION AND ADJUSTMENTº, ªTorsion Bar
Springº, FA-31. Adjust wheel alignment if necessary.
(4) If wheel alignment is not as specified, but dimension ªHº is correct, adjust wheel alignment.
CAMBER, CASTER AND KINGPIN INCLINATION
Before checking camber, caster or kingpin inclination, move
vehicle up and down on turning radius gauge to minimize
friction. Ensure that vehicle is in correct posture (unladen
vehicle).
IMeasure camber, caster and kingpin inclination of both
right and left wheels with a suitable alignment gauge and
adjust in accordance with the following procedures.

TOE-IN
1. Mark a base line across the tread.
After lowering front of vehicle, move it up and down to elimi-
nate friction, and set steering wheel in straight ahead position.
2. Measure toe-in.
Measure distance ªAº and ªBº at the same height as hub cen-
ter.Toe-in (Unladen):Refer to SDS, FA-39.
Toe-in = A þ B
3. Adjust toe-in by varying the length of steering tie-rods.
(1) Loosen clamp bolts or lock nuts.
(2) Adjust toe-in by turning the left and right tie-rod tubes an equal amount.
Make sure that the tie-rod bars are screwed into the tie-rod
tube more than 32.5 mm (1.280 in).
Make sure that the tie-rods are the same length. Standard length (A = B):287 mm (11.30 in)
(3) Tighten clamp bolts or lock nuts, to the specified torque.

Precautions
IUse only ªDOT 4º fluid from a sealed container.
I Never reuse drained brake fluid.
I Be careful not to splash brake fluid on painted areas; it
may cause paint damage. If brake fluid is splashed on
painted areas, wash it away with water immediately.
I To clean master cylinder parts, disc brake caliper parts or
wheel cylinder parts, use clean brake fluid.
I Never use mineral oils such as Petrol or kerosene. They
will ruin rubber parts of hydraulic system.
I Use flare nut wrench when removing and installing brake
tubes.
I Always torque brake lines when installing.
I Burnish the brake contact surfaces after refinishing or
replacing drums or rotors, after replacing pads or linings,
or if a soft pedal occurs at very low speed. Refer to ªBrake
Burnishing Procedureº, ªCheck and Adjustmentº, BR-5.
WARNING:
I Clean brakes with a vacuum dust collector to minimize risk
of health hazard from airborne materials.
I Avoid prolonged and repeated skin contact with brake
fluid.
I Wear protective clothing, including impervious gloves.
I Where there is a risk of eye contact, eye protection should
be worn Ð for example chemical goggles or face shield.
